#f71c38 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#f71c38 is composed of 96.9% red, 11% green and 22%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 88.7% magenta, 77.3% yellow and 3.1% black. It has a hue angle of 352.3 degrees, a saturation of 93.2% and a lightness of 53.9%. #f71c38 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ff3870 with #ef0000. Closest websafe color is: #ff3333.

Shades and Tints of #f71c38
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000000 is the darkest color, while #feecef is the lightest one.

Tones of #f71c38
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#8b8889 is the less saturated color, while #f71c38 is the most saturated one.
